Default See both TV and computer screen at SAME time?

A friend of mine has the NVIDIA GeForce 2 and he can switch from TV to his
CPU monitor. He likes to be able to see both the TV and the monitor and the
same time. This is NOT TV program, but the output from his computer to the
large screen TV. In other words, he likes to see the SAME output of his
program under Windows ME on his computer screen and his TV.

How does he do that?

go to the NVidia control panel (display properties - settings - advance -
GeForce...) there you'll find a label called NView.
set it to Clone and there you go (but if you want an exact cloned display,
you'll have to settle for 800x600 or lower - ATI doesn't has this limit but
otherwise they suck).
notice that it'll have an impact on performance (FPS will drop about half or
so)
